Active voice places the subject of the sentence front and center, conveying a sense of immediacy and action. In contrast, passive voice relegates the subject to the background, leading to ambiguity and detachment. Consider the following examples:
- Passive: The ball was kicked by the boy.
- Active: The boy kicked the ball.
Key features of active voice:
- Subject Performs the Action: In an active voice sentence, the subject is the agent or doer of the action expressed by the verb.
Example: The cat chased the mouse. In this sentence, “The cat” is the subject performing the action of chasing.
- Clear and Direct Communication: Active voice contributes to clarity and directness in writing. It highlights the doer of the action and allows for more straightforward and engaging communication.
Example: The chef prepared a delicious meal. The active construction clearly indicates that the chef (the subject) is responsible for preparing the meal.
- Subject-Verb-Object Structure: Active voice sentences typically follow a subject-verb-object structure, where the subject acts on the object.
Example: Subject (The chef) – Verb (prepared) – Object (a delicious meal).
- Easier to Understand: Active voice is often preferred in various forms of writing, including academic, business, and creative contexts, as it tends to be more concise and easier for readers to understand.
Example: The committee reviewed the proposal. The active construction clearly indicates that the committee (the subject) is conducting the review.
